Animal proteins in feed : annual report 2009-2010 of the Dutch National Reference Laboratory

RIKILT serves as the only official control laboratory for animal proteins in feeds in the Netherlands in the framework of Directive 882/2004/EC. As National Reference Laboratory (NRL), RIKILT participated in 2 annual proficiency tests during the reporting period, in 2 additional interlaboratory studies addressing quantification issues, and in the annual meetings of EURL. In addition, RIKILT participated in a validation study for identification of bovine material by means of DNA analysis, in a workshop, and in a meeting in China. The interlaboratory study for DNA detection of bovine material showed that different protocols are comparable and that the identification of bovine material is feasible.
